But this did not happen.\u00a0 On the contrary, Prime Minister Modi was uncommonly blunt and precise in calling on his Sri Lankan counterpart to begin delivering on his oft-repeated promise to the international community of a political solution that goes beyond the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/?s=13th+Amendment&amp;x=8&amp;y=3\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line;\">13th Amendment<\/span><\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>It was believed that because both President Rajapaksa and Prime Minister Modi come from nationalist traditions, there would be a meeting of hearts and minds and that they would understand and empathise with each other as they were thought to be on the same wavelength.\u00a0 The Sri Lankan government was hoping that Prime Minister Modi\u2019s nationalist inclinations would make him focus on economic ties with Sri Lanka rather than on minority rights.\u00a0 This might have been possible if the two leaders were not from neighbouring countries, where the actions of one spilled over into the other country.\u00a0 For instance there could be a meeting of minds between the leaders of Sri Lanka and Russia where it concerns dealing with separatist insurgencies.\u00a0 Both countries ended up dealing with their separatists with military force and finally succeeded in crushing them.<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_125212\" style=\"width: 400px\" class=\"wp-caption alignleft\"><a href=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/Mahinda-Modi2.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-125212\" class=\"size-full wp-image-125212\" alt=\"Inasmuch as President Mahinda Rajapaksa\u2019s nationalism is in relation to Sri Lanka, so would the Indian Prime Minister\u2019s nationalism be in relation to India\u2019s national interest.\" src=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/Mahinda-Modi2.jpg\" width=\"390\" height=\"293\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/Mahinda-Modi2.jpg 390w, https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/Mahinda-Modi2-300x225.jpg 300w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 390px) 100vw, 390px\" \/><\/a><p id=\"caption-attachment-125212\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Inasmuch as President Mahinda Rajapaksa\u2019s nationalism is in relation to Sri Lanka, so would the Indian Prime Minister\u2019s nationalism be in relation to India\u2019s national interest.<\/p><\/div>\n<p>However, there is less reason to believe that two nationalisms that are next door to each other could cooperate.\u00a0\u00a0 Those who are nationalists tend to look at issues from the perspective of their own countries and the interests of those they deem to be their own.\u00a0 It is generally universalists or liberals who think of the larger picture and the wellbeing of all that transcends their own nationality. The boycott of the swearing in ceremony by the main political leaders of Tamil Nadu state and the emotional reaction in Tamil Nadu over the invitation extended to the Sri Lankan president would have sent a message to the Indian policymakers that the issue of Sri Lanka has to be handled carefully. \u00a0Inasmuch as President Mahinda Rajapaksa\u2019s nationalism is in relation to Sri Lanka, so would the Indian Prime Minister\u2019s nationalism be in relation to India\u2019s national interest.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Reiterating Policy<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>It is unlikely that Prime Minister was actually ever considering a new type of relationship with neigbouring Sri Lanka.\u00a0 His interests have not been with the south of India but rather with issues in the north, where his government won most of its seats and also faces the most serious challenges to its national security.\u00a0 Now the new government needs to consolidate itself in the south of India where it did not fare well at the general elections. The primary need would be to restore relations with Tamil Nadu. The Indian government would not wish to antagonize one of its largest states.\u00a0\u00a0 Simply because his government has an absolute majority in Parliament by itself, Prime Minster Modi will not wish to disregard those states in which the opposition parties have done well.\u00a0 He would also not wish to disregard the advice of the civil service that outlives governments and forms the backbone of long term Indian policy making.<\/p>\n<p>Sri Lanka itself provides an example of a very strong government, enjoying a 2\/3 majority in Parliament, faces problems in governance due to its inability to win the confidence and support of its Northern Province. Having a majority in Parliament does not eliminate the need to have good relations with the constituent units of the country.\u00a0 It would be unwise for any government to jeopardize its internal relations for the sake of external ones. Accordingly, it is not surprising that Prime Minister Modi has reiterated what his predecessor in office has insisted was the way forward.\u00a0 In his meeting with President Rajapaka after being sworn in, he had asked the President to take the reconciliation process forward without delay.\u00a0 He had said that the full implementation of the 13th Amendment and, even more, going beyond it would contribute to the reconciliation process.<\/p>\n<p>There is a danger in the current situation that delay in addressing Indian concerns could aggravate Indo-Sri Lankan problems.\u00a0 As a nationalist, Prime Minister Modi\u2019s interests are Indian.\u00a0 He has also been projected as an efficient leader who is in a hurry to get things done. This makes it likely that he will show impatience if he sees nothing but delays and excuses coming from the Sri Lankan side.\u00a0 It was after four years of delay that the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/?s=UNHRC&amp;x=7&amp;y=2\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line;\">UN Human Rights Council<\/span><\/a> finally decided to appoint international investigators into war crimes in Sri Lanka, as the Sri Lankan side dragged its feet on addressing the issue. The government must not repeat with India what it has ended up with the UNHRC through its delays and denials, which is an internationally sanction investigation.\u00a0 The people of India voted for Prime Minister Modi to be their strong leader, and Sri Lanka should not seek to become a test case for a show of his strength.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Pragmatic Calculation<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ong><\/strong>During the war President Rajapaksa promised Indian leaders to implement the 13th Amendment and even go beyond it to an undefined \u201c13 Plus\u201d.\u00a0 President Rajapaksa made this promise to induce India and the Western countries to support his government\u2019s efforts to militarily defeat the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/?s=LTTE&amp;x=7&amp;y=4\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line;\">LTTE<\/span><\/a>.\u00a0\u00a0 The understanding was that after the LTTE was eliminated there would be nothing that could stand in the way of a just political solution and implementation of the provincial council system in an exemplary manner.\u00a0 It would be judicious if the Sri Lankan government proceeds to expeditiously implement its promise regarding the system of devolution of power.\u00a0 Instead of dragging its feet on the implementation of the 13th Amendment, it would be in Sri Lanka\u2019s national interest to set about improving on the workings of this arrangement so that it meets the interests of all concerned.<\/p>\n<p>The Sri Lankan government\u2019s immediate response to Prime Minister Modi\u2019s statement on the 13th Amendment is to refer to the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/?s=Parliamentary+Select+Committee&amp;x=8&amp;y=3\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line;\">Parliamentary Select Committee<\/span><\/a> appointed by President Rajapaksa for the purpose of finding a political solution.\u00a0 However, so far the PSC has been a non-starter.\u00a0 None of the opposition parties have agreed to join it. None of them appear to believe in the government\u2019s sincerity and see in it a time-buying exercise.\u00a0 In these circumstances it is not reasonable for the government to expect the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.colombotelegraph.com\/?s=TNA&amp;x=9&amp;y=3\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line;\">TNA<\/span><\/a>, which represents the majority of Tamil people, to join the PSC.\u00a0 The government needs to build the confidence of the opposition parties, and especially the TNA, in the value of the PSC process.\u00a0 The special concern of the TNA is that the PSC will reproduce the same ethnic majoritarian decision making formula that led to the separatist war in the first place.<\/p>\n<p>The ethnic conflict arose because the ethnic minorities disagreed with the ethnic majority having the numerical majority to always outvote them when it came to matters that involved their interests.\u00a0 The government needs to give an answer to his problem by re-shaping the method of decision making within the PSC.\u00a0 It has to find ways to ensure that decision making within the PSC is by consensus rather than by simple majority vote, whereby the ethnic minorities will once again be outvoted as they always have been in the past.\u00a0 One solution would be to adopt the method of \u201csufficient consensus\u201d adopted by the South African parties when they were negotiating a political solution to their own civil conflict.\u00a0 This simply meant that all the important parties should agree to the solutions that were presented.\u00a0 In practice it meant that the main governing party and the ANC had to agree.\u00a0 With South Africa\u2019s good offices, which it has offered, a similar arrangement can be developed for Sri Lanka.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p> [&hellip;]<\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":22,"featured_media":42344,"comment_status":"open","ping_status":"closed","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"_jetpack_memberships_contains_paid_content":false,"footnotes":""},"categories":[3,8],"tags":[],"class_list":["post-125378","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","has-post-thumbnail","hentry","category-colombotelegraph","category-editorial"],"yoast_head":"<!-- This site is optimized with the Yoast SEO plugin v26.3 -
